
Suman Takhar
Founder & Director
Suman’s journey into early learning is deeply rooted in care, connection, and a genuine love for children and families. With a background in social work, she spent years supporting families through vulnerable and transitional moments—experiences that shaped her belief that feeling safe, seen, and supported is the foundation for all growth.
In 2015, guided by her heart and a calling to be closer to children during their earliest and most formative years, Suman returned to school to pursue her education in Early Childhood Education. This allowed her to thoughtfully weave together her social work background with early learning practice, creating an approach that is nurturing, intentional, and deeply responsive to each child’s unique needs.
Suman believes that childhood should be filled with warmth, trust, and meaningful relationships. She is passionate about creating environments where children feel deeply loved, emotionally secure, and confident in who they are. Her philosophy centres on connection—connection to self, to others, and to a community that celebrates kindness, empathy, and belonging.
As Founder and Director, Suman leads with compassion and heart, striving to create a space where children flourish, educators feel valued, and families feel supported and at home. Connections is not just a centre to her—it is a reflection of her values and her belief in the power of love, presence, and intentional care in the early years.
